After doing a chat, calling and getting hung up when I was placed on hold, and now struggling to get back to an agent, I hope someone could offer some guidance.
In a nutshell the download speeds I have for the Nintendo switch on the unlimited package are slow, 5-7 Mbps (Ie less than a megabyte per second). However every other device, TV, PC, Xbox, phone etc have been fine and download at speeds I would expect.
I've done updates, power cycled, done an ethernet connection to the router, and all are slow. However when I tried another network it worked fine.
The advisor on the phone mentioned "provisioning", but would that explain why it effects just the device? If so what do I need to do?

There are widespread issues reported with the flaky wifi chipset on the Switch, even on 1Gig BB, it can be flaky from my own experience....
And nothing to do with o2.
Have a look at this guide and in particular switching from the congested 2.4Ghz network to 5Ghz

Read the T&C's for unlimited data use.
Routers cannot be connected to mains and traffic is monitored etc, so you may be restricted by O2 if your use does not comply.
https://www.o2.co.uk/termsandconditions/mobile/unlimited-tariff-terms
3.3 Unlimited UK Data sold on handset or SIMO contracts must only be used in mobile devices that do not require to be plugged in order to work. Any O2 mobile broadband Unlimited UK Data tariffs must only be used with the devices that they are sold with. Where other devices are used that do not comply with these terms, we reserve the right to transfer you to a more suitable plan.
